Jaclyn Jones
Senior Consultant, North American Region
Jaclyn Jones is a strategic leader with over 15 years of experience in business management, human resources, and educational consulting. At 360 Zolo Solutions, she develops innovative strategies and operational processes to support client growth and success.
Previously, Jaclyn served as a Human Resources Executive at Target, where she led a team of over 200 employees, drove compliance initiatives, and fostered a culture of high performance. Her background also includes managing multimillion-dollar construction projects, international teaching roles, and consulting on business process improvements.
Jaclyn holds a Master of Arts in Educational Leadership from New York University and a Bachelor of Business Administration from Ohio University, graduating magna cum laude. Fluent in Spanish and experienced in global environments, she brings a collaborative and results-oriented approach to every challenge.
